Python – Unpack Tuples
I Python er tuples en af de datatyper, der tillader os at gemme flere elementer i en enkelt variabel. Når vi arbejder med tuples, kan det være nyttigt at kunne unpacke dem, dvs. at adskille elementerne i tuplen og gemme dem i separate variabler. Denne funktion kaldes tuple unpacking i Python og det kan være meget nyttigt i mange situationer. Lad os undersøge, hvordan man kan udføre tuple unpacking i Python.
Hvad er Tuple Unpacking i Python?
Tuple unpacking refererer til processen med at adskille elementerne i en tuple og gemme dem i individuelle variabler. Dette gør det muligt at få adgang til hvert element i tuplen separat, hvilket kan være praktisk i mange tilfælde. For at udføre tuple unpacking i Python, skal antallet af variabler svare til antallet af elementer i tuplen.
Sådan Udføres Tuple Unpacking i Python
For at udføre tuple unpacking i Python, skal du følge disse trin:
- Opret en tuple med de elementer, du ønsker at adskille.
- Definer de variabler, der skal gemme de enkelte elementer.
- Brug syntaxen til tuple unpacking til at adskille elementerne og gemme dem i variablerne.
Her er et simpelt eksempel på, hvordan man kan udføre tuple unpacking i Python:
# Opret en tuplemy_tuple = (1, 2, 3)# Unpack tuplena, b, c = my_tupleprint(a) # Output: 1print(b) # Output: 2print(c) # Output: 3
Fordele ved Tuple Unpacking
Der er flere fordele ved at bruge tuple unpacking i Python:
- Enkelhed: Det gør det nemt at adskille og arbejde med de enkelte elementer i tuplen.
- Læsbarhed: Det gør koden mere læselig og forståelig.
- Fleksibilitet: Det giver mulighed for at arbejde med data på en mere effektiv måde.
Afsluttende tanker
Pythons tuple unpacking funktionalitet tilbyder en elegant løsning til at adskille og arbejde med tuplers elementer på en effektiv og enkel måde.
Udforsk tuple unpacking i Python for at opnå en dybere forståelse af, hvordan du kan udnytte denne funktion til at forbedre dine programmeringsfærdigheder og effektiviteten af din kode.
Hvad er tuple unpacking i Python?
Hvad er syntaxen for tuple unpacking i Python?
Hvordan fungerer tuple unpacking i Python?
Hvorfor er tuple unpacking nyttigt i Python?
Kan man unpacke en tuple direkte i en funktion i Python?
Hvordan kan man unpacke en tuple med et vilkårligt antal elementer i Python?
Hvad sker der, hvis antallet af variabler ikke passer til antallet af værdier i tuplen under unpacking i Python?
Kan man bruge tuple unpacking til at bytte værdier mellem to variabler i Python?
Hvordan kan man kombinere tuple unpacking med andre teknikker som list comprehension i Python?
Hvad er forskellen mellem tuple unpacking og list unpacking i Python?
Bootstrap Navigation Bar – alt du skal vide om navigationsmenuen i Bootstrap • C While Loop: En dybdegående guide • Sådan oprettes en overlay med CSS • C Online Compiler (Editor / Interpreter) • SQL Server DATEPART() Funktion • Sass @mixin and @include • Alt hvad du behøver at vide om React Memo • Java: Sådan udskrives/vises variabler • Java final Keyword: En dybdegående guide • Python – Slicing Strings •
